Abstract
A toner comprising: a plurality of mother particles; and a plurality of external additive particles to be attached to the mother particles, the external additive particles including external additive particles attached to the mother particle and external additive particles liberated from the mother particles, wherein an inclination (particle sizes of the external additives/particle sizes of the mother particles) of an approximation straight line obtained by approximating distribution of particle sizes of the external additives with respect to the particle sizes of the mother particles by a least-square method is not larger than 0.6. Also, disclosed is an image forming apparatus using the toner.
